Transaction 343fedc256e8c2493b5434dd16e91b48f6e94d75b376b17576780cbe698af84d
1 Input
1 Output
-
343fedc256e8c2493b5434dd16e91b48f6e94d75b376b17576780cbe698af84d:0
- value
- 1147049
- script pubkey
- OP_0 OP_PUSHBYTES_32 d20057d811bee8139c0323272b2cf650d7302f87e6a0abd6c3030b8f213808ae
- address
- bc1q6gq90kq3hm5p88qryvnjkt8k2rtnqtu8u6s2h4krqv9c7gfcpzhqp70r7r